Viking Star: More Than Just a Number

When we talk about the Viking Stars cruise ship capacityroughly 930 passengerswere not just counting heads. This number reflects a thoughtful balance between intimacy and community. The ship isnt a floating city packed with thousands of travelers. Instead, its a carefully designed space that allows guests plenty of room to breathe, explore, and enjoy true comfort.

That number feels just rightlike a longship crew ready to face new horizons while staying close-knit. Its a capacity that invites camaraderie without overwhelming personal space, echoing Viking cultures emphasis on close bonds and shared adventure.

Whats in a Number? The Practical Side of 930 Passengers

Of course, cruise ship capacity affects more than just the social atmosphere. It shapes the ships amenities, dining options, and overall sense of luxury. With under a thousand guests, the Viking Star can offer multiple gourmet restaurants without long waits or overcrowding. This size allows spaces like pools, lounges, and public areas where you can relax quietly or meet new friends.
